• <br />• <br />APPROPRIATION <br />Hedgerow Properties Appropriation <br />$130,664 (Rev); $127,700 (Exp) <br />WHEREAS, the City of Charlottesville and the County of Albemarle jointly <br />purchased properties from the Hedgerow Corporation on April 29, 2005, which is governed <br />by an intergovernmental agreement, dated July 20, 2004; and <br />WHEREAS, the City serves as the fiscal agent for this agreement. <br />N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ED by the Council of the City of <br />Charlottesville, Virginia, that the following revenues and expenditures are appropriated in the <br />following manner: <br />Revenues - $130,664 <br />Amount: $35,624 Fund: 105 Internal Order: 2000037 G/L Account: 450030 <br />Amount: $95,040 Fund: 105 Internal Order: 2000037 G/L Account: 434372 <br />Expenditures - $127,700 <br />Amount: $40,000 Fund: 105 Internal Order: 2000037 G/L Account: 530040 <br />Amount: $29,000 Fund: 105 Internal Order: 2000037 G/L Account: 530200 <br />Amount: $58,700 Fund: 105 Internal Order: 2000037 G/L Account: 530670 <br />B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that this appropriation shall not expire at the end of <br />the fiscal year, but shall continue in effect unless altered by further action of City Council. <br />Approved by Council <br />May 1, 2006 <br />C er of City Council <br />
